The process of mining Bitcoin is a crucial aspect of the cryptocurrency ecosystem. It involves the verification of transactions, the addition of new blocks to the blockchain, and the reward of miners for their efforts. In this article, we will delve into the intricacies of the process of mining Bitcoin, providing a comprehensive guide for those interested in understanding how it works.
The Process of Mining Bitcoin: An Overview
The process of mining Bitcoin begins with the creation of a new block. A block is a collection of transactions that have yet to be confirmed. Miners are responsible for adding these blocks to the blockchain, which is a decentralized ledger of all Bitcoin transactions.
To mine a block, miners must solve a complex mathematical puzzle. This puzzle is designed to be computationally intensive, requiring significant processing power. The first miner to solve the puzzle is rewarded with Bitcoin, along with transaction fees.
The Process of Mining Bitcoin: Step-by-Step
1. Setting Up a Mining Rig
The first step in the process of mining Bitcoin is to set up a mining rig. A mining rig is a specialized computer designed for mining cryptocurrencies. It consists of a powerful graphics processing unit (GPU) or an application-specific integrated circuit (ASIC) miner.
2. Joining a Mining Pool
Mining solo can be challenging, as the chances of solving the mathematical puzzle and earning a reward are slim. To increase their chances, miners often join a mining pool. A mining pool is a group of miners who work together to solve the puzzle, and the rewards are distributed proportionally to the amount of computing power contributed by each miner.
3. Installing Mining Software
Once you have set up your mining rig and joined a mining pool, you need to install mining software. This software will connect your rig to the mining pool and allow you to start mining Bitcoin. There are various mining software options available, such as CGMiner, BFGMiner, and Claymore.
4. Configuring Your Mining Rig
After installing the mining software, you need to configure your mining rig. This involves entering your mining pool's information, such as the pool's URL, your username, and password. You may also need to adjust the mining software's settings to optimize performance.
5. Mining Bitcoin
With your mining rig configured, you can now start mining Bitcoin. The mining software will begin solving the mathematical puzzle, and if your rig is part of a mining pool, it will work together with other miners to solve the puzzle. Once the puzzle is solved, a new block is added to the blockchain, and you will receive a portion of the reward, along with transaction fees.
The Process of Mining Bitcoin: Challenges and Rewards
Mining Bitcoin is a challenging endeavor. The difficulty of the mathematical puzzle increases as more miners join the network, making it more difficult to solve the puzzle and earn a reward. Additionally, the cost of electricity and hardware can be significant.
Despite these challenges, mining Bitcoin can be a rewarding experience. Miners who successfully solve the puzzle and add a new block to the blockchain are rewarded with Bitcoin. This reward serves as an incentive for miners to continue contributing to the network and securing the blockchain.
